熱點推薦:
您现在的位置: 電腦知識網 >> 編程 >> Java編程 >> JSP教程 >> 正文

解析jQuery與其它js(Prototype)庫兼容共存

2013-11-15 12:12:41  來源: JSP教程 
解決jQuery與其它js(Prototype)庫沖突的方法很簡單就是使用jQuery的jQuerynoConflict()函數以下小編就為大家介紹需要的朋友可以參考下  

  在運行這個函數後可以恢復使用別名 $ 在這個函數的作用域中仍然將 $ 作為 jQuery 的別名來使用
jQuery Code

復制代碼 代碼如下:
jQuerynoConflict();
(function($) {
  $(function() {
    // 使用 $ 作為 jQuery 別名的代碼
  });
})(jQuery);
// 基於其他庫用 $ 作為別名的代碼

  
在運行這個函數後可以創建一個新的 jQuery 別名來替換原來的 jQuery 別名 $ 來使用
jQuery Code

復制代碼 代碼如下:
var j = jQuerynoConflict();
// 使用新別名 jQuery 的代碼
j("div p")hide();
// 基於其他庫用 $ 作為別名的代碼
$("content")styledisplay = none;

  
注意這個函數必須在你導入 jQuery 文件之後並且在導入另一個導致沖突的庫之前使用


From:http://tw.wingwit.com/Article/program/Java/JSP/201311/20499.html
    推薦文章
    Copyright © 2005-2013 電腦知識網 Computer Knowledge   All rights reserved.